ObjectSecurity.ModifyAccess Méthode
Définition
Important
Certaines informations portent sur la préversion du produit qui est susceptible d’être en grande partie modifiée avant sa publication. Microsoft exclut toute garantie, expresse ou implicite, concernant les informations fournies ici.
Applique la modification spécifiée à la liste de contrôle d’accès discrétionnaire (DACL) associée à cet ObjectSecurity objet.
protected:
abstract bool ModifyAccess(System::Security::AccessControl::AccessControlModification modification, System::Security::AccessControl::AccessRule ^ rule, [Runtime::InteropServices::Out] bool % modified);
protected abstract bool ModifyAccess(System.Security.AccessControl.AccessControlModification modification, System.Security.AccessControl.AccessRule rule, out bool modified);
abstract member ModifyAccess : System.Security.AccessControl.AccessControlModification * System.Security.AccessControl.AccessRule * bool -> bool
Protected MustOverride Function ModifyAccess (modification As AccessControlModification, rule As AccessRule, ByRef modified As Boolean) As Boolean
Paramètres
- modification
- AccessControlModification
Modification à appliquer à la liste dacl.
- rule
- AccessRule
Règle d’accès à modifier.
- modified
- Boolean
true si la liste DACL est correctement modifiée ; sinon, false.
Retours
true si la liste DACL est correctement modifiée ; sinon, false.
Remarques
Pour éviter d’autoriser involontairement l’accès aux principaux, les applications doivent vérifier l’existence d’une entrée de contrôle d’accès (AEFA) d’accès complète (AEFA) et la supprimer avant de modifier une liste DACL.